Green Day Café
Finally, a healthy “fast food” restaurant. Green Day Café has the freshest ingredients for healthy wraps and salads. Going green is all in the details: Disposable take out containers made from paper, paper straws, utensils made from sugar cane and even the walls and interior are green (literally). Careful Planet Toys
This local online store features eco-friendly and educational toys safe for the environment and your child. Games about planet earth and how to protect it, fun and very cool looking Bugabikes made from recycled materials, and toys made from non-toxic dyes and hardwood make up the “green” toy offerings. Fun toys for digging in the sand and play kitchen items are also available. Kids will have so much fun they might forget the positive impact they are having on the environment. www.carefulplanettoys.com

Orlando Science Center’s Preschool
You will find your kids clinging to the “tree of life” in the center of the Kid’s Town, just to stay at school longer. This play-based preschool is geared for tots ages 3 to 5. The kids rotate throughout the day for exciting lessons in science, art, dramatic play, reading and more. The class is limited to 20 kids and has mixed ages to nurture future Einsteins. “Field trips” outside the classroom are taken to exciting exhibits throughout the Science Center. And what kid wouldn’t want to take recess inside Kid’s Town? www.osc.org
